I had a HD crash (an of course it was not backed up)
I have installed a new HD and also installed Windows 7 32bit Home edition.
I am looking for the drivers and HP apps the came with the PC.
I believe the model is [edit]. Although it may be [edit] . It is hard to tell if after the "L" whether it is "Zero" or the letter "O".
Can you point to where I can download the drives and HP Software?

Hi:
The dv9912nr only had drivers for Windows Vista.
HP retires support for all consumer class products more than 10 years old, which is why you can't find any info for it anywhere.
The good news is that most of the drivers still exist on the HP ftp server and the Vista drivers should work for W7.
Here are most of the drivers you need...
Chipset:
ftp://ftp.hp.com/pub/softpaq/sp37501-38000/sp37730.exe
Graphics: You will have to manually install the driver as follows...
Run the driver. You will most likely get an unsupported operating system error. Close out of any error windows.
ftp://ftp.hp.com/pub/softpaq/sp42501-43000/sp42635.exe
Go to the device manager. Click to expand the display adapters device manager category. Click on the Standard VGA Adapter listed there...It may also be listed elsewhere in the device manager labeled as a Video Controller. Click on whichever one you have.
Click on the driver tab. Click on Update driver. Select the Browse my computer for driver software option and browse to the driver folder that was created when you ran the file.
That folder will be located in C:\SWSetup\sp42635.
Make sure the Include Subfolders box is checked, and the driver should install. Then restart the PC.
